It sounds like it is definately the o2 sensor. I would imagine that yer plugs are just fine (although it wouldn't hurt to change em). When your o2 sensor doesn't read right, it will cause your engine to run funny like that by giving yer ecu false readings. Yer ecu then compensates for those false readings and makes yer car run like crap.

yes, they are bad if used too much... your fuel system really doesnt need all that... When I have experienced a o2 sensor going bad, my a/f gauge always reads lean, that causes your ecu to throw more fuel at your engine... i dont have that problem, my ecu says +20% increase in fuel due to unhooked o2 sensors, but my factory injector harness is unhooked and the accel dfi controls all that now..
